Summary
The documentation page exhibits a Windows bias by exclusively deploying Windows Server virtual machines in the example Bicep template and mentioning only Windows VMs in the network description. There are no Linux VM examples or references, and the deployment instructions do not address Linux-specific considerations. However, the Azure CLI and PowerShell instructions are both provided, which mitigates some bias in deployment tooling.
Recommendations
  • Include Linux VM deployment examples alongside Windows Server VMs in the Bicep template and documentation narrative.
  • Mention that the Bicep template can be adapted for Linux VMs and provide sample parameters or code snippets for common Linux distributions (e.g., Ubuntu, CentOS).
  • Clarify that adminUsername/adminPassword can be used for both Windows and Linux VMs, and note any differences (e.g., SSH keys for Linux).
  • Add a note or section on how to connect to Linux VMs after deployment, including SSH instructions.
  • Ensure parity in troubleshooting and validation steps for both Windows and Linux environments.
